Abstract
The present utility model discloses a method for producing coconut pulp (Cocos nucifera) cookies that addresses the problem of agricultural waste accumulation resulting from the underutilization of coconut pulp, a by-product of coconut milk extraction. The process provides a novel solution by incorporating coconut pulp as a major functional ingredient in cookie production. The method comprises grating the coconut meat to obtain pulp, weighing and sifting the dry ingredients, creaming butter and sugar, gradually incorporating eggs, and mixing the coconut pulp with the dry ingredients to form a dough. The dough is then chilled to enhance texture, portioned onto a baking sheet, baked in a preheated oven until fully cooked, cooled for stabilization, and packed in suitable packaging for storage and distribution. The principal use of this utility model is the production of a sustainable, high-fiber cookie intended for human consumption
